Ophthalmologists on the Move: Drs. Frank Hwang, Reecha Sachdeva-Bahl and Justin Tannir Join MI’s Kresge Eye Institute

Three new ophthalmologists have joined Michigan’s Kresge Eye Institute, according to a Troy Patch report.

The physicians are Frank Hwang, MD, who speciales in cornea, cataract and Lasik; Reecha Sachdeva-Bahl, MD, who specializes in pediatric ophthalmology and adult strabismus; and Justin Tannir, M.D., who specializes in glaucoma, cataract and related eye diseases.

 

The new ophthalmologists will see patients at several Kresge Eye Institute locations throughout Michigan, including Detroit, Dearborn and Bingham Farms.

 

Kresge clinical ophthalmologists are also Wayne State University School of Medicine faculty members.
